Como Jugar Al Iafas Casino Un excelente servicio al cliente siempre ha sido una característica esencial de los casinos confiables. Nuevo Casino Sevilla Relax Gaming siempre se asegura de que puedas jugar a sus tragamonedas en todos los dispositivos. Casas De Juegos Casino
The actual query isn’t MongoDB vs PostgreSQL, however rather the best document database vs the best relational database. MongoDB’s horizontal scalability and high availability mean it’s ideal for handling transactional knowledge in financial methods. MongoDB is a NoSQL database with a flexible data mannequin, excessive efficiency, and effective horizontal scaling. Each PostgreSQL and MongoDB use a type of load balancing to evenly distribute learn operations across multiple replicas whereas reaching a high degree of scalability. Their distributed architecture processes move knowledge to improve performance.
It ensures isolation by offering completely different levels of transaction isolation from read committed to serializable. It ensures durability https://www.globalcloudteam.com/ by writing adjustments to the disk before acknowledging a transaction commit. MongoDB shops knowledge as collections of paperwork in a flexible, binary JSON-like format called BSON (Binary JSON). This permits you to store and retrieve information in a extra flexible and scalable means, without having to evolve to a inflexible information schema. BSON extends the JSON format to incorporate extra information sorts like dates, binary information, and decimal numbers. PostgreSQL shops knowledge as structured objects and uses schema for SQL databases.
It can question and retrieve content material rapidly and handle many concurrent learn and write operations. This makes it a good choice for high-traffic content material management applications. Selecting between MongoDB and PostgreSQL is decided by your specific use case. MongoDB is suited to initiatives requiring flexibility and scalability with unstructured knowledge, while PostgreSQL is ideal for initiatives needing knowledge consistency, complex queries, and ACID compliance. Choosing between MongoDB and PostgreSQL depends on your specific project needs overfitting in ml.
These reads are directed to multiple nodes within the reproduction set till the quickest node replies. On the other hand, MongoDB permits you to retailer knowledge in any structure that can be rapidly accessed by indexing, regardless of how deeply nested in arrays or subdocuments. BSON skips the keys that aren’t helpful for the question, thus making it sooner to retrieve information. A consumer could further outline the document’s structure and undertake some development by introducing new fields, reworking knowledge, or developing it each time they see match. With MongoDB, you can store knowledge as documents in a binary representation known as binary JSON (BSON).
Lastly, it highlights a few challenges you might face if you use these databases. Learn along how one can select the best database for your organization. Airbyte additionally allows knowledge groups to scale their operations through seamless integrations with hundreds of functions to accommodate rising data volumes, customers, and processes.
Its versatile schema allows for indexing of nested fields and arrays inside paperwork, which is particularly useful for advanced information structures. MongoDB also offers specialized indexes like unique, sparse, and TTL (Time-To-Live) indexes to cater to particular use circumstances. MongoDB’s architecture makes use of paperwork, which are the identical as information in relational databases but can maintain extra complicated and various constructions.
Airbyte pipelines may help streamline your data ecosystem by centralizing knowledge from all related sources, databases, and functions. Information engineers also can construct custom connectors in minutes for their unique use circumstances. After exploring the nuances of both the databases, contemplate checking out our article on migrating from MongoDB to Postgres leveraging Airbyte, a dynamic information integration platform. The doc database has been efficiently implemented to drive data operations in leading international firms, with MongoDB Atlas being utilized by Forbes, Toyota, Vodafone, and extra. One of the main challenges while building a software software is data storage. PostgreSQL is available under the PostgreSQL License, a permissive license that permits customers to change and distribute the software as they see fit.
IntroductionWhen it comes to selecting a database administration system (DBMS) on your project, there are a plethora of options out there in the market. Both databases have their very own strengths and weaknesses, and understanding the critical differences between them might help you make an informed choice on which one to make use of on your particular needs. MongoDB provides superior features like sharding, which allows you to add more servers to your MongoDB cluster and distribute your information across them. This horizontal scaling reduces load and creates a extremely scalable structure to handle increased demand, corresponding to sudden spikes in net traffic. One of the key benefits of sharding is that it can be carried out with out downtime, ensuring continuous availability of your application.
Owing to its multi-document transactions functionality, MongoDB is probably certainly one of the few databases to coalesce the flexibleness, pace, and power of the doc mannequin with the ACID ensures of traditional databases. The important thing to note here is that transactions allow various adjustments to a database to both be made or rolled again in a gaggle. Due To This Fact when to use mongodb vs postgres, in a relational database, the information could be modeled across impartial parent-child tables in a tabular schema. Relational databases are great at operating complicated queries and data-based reporting in circumstances the place the information structure doesn’t change frequently.
You can change document structures inside a group without affecting other paperwork, making it appropriate for evolving semi-structured or unstructured data. PostgreSQL, usually referred to as “Postgres,” is a powerful open-source relational database administration system (RDBMS) known for its robust give consideration to information high quality, superior querying capabilities, and extensibility. When choosing a database on your application, one of the essential decisions is whether or not to make use of a relational database like PostgreSQL or a NoSQL database like MongoDB. Both are highly effective tools, however they serve totally different functions and are optimized for various sorts of workloads. In this article, we’ll present a technical comparison of PostgreSQL and MongoDB, helping builders understand the strengths and weaknesses of every and providing steerage on when to choose one over the other.
Each tuple holds a single document under a particular information kind that the column defines. Alongside the information values, every tuple also contains metadata like the primary key, which identifies every tuple within a table. Postgres has an extensible architecture and continues to be maintained by the neighborhood. The Postgres ecosystem isthriving lately, it has a plethora of extensions makingit extra capable of handling different workloads than different databases.
This consists of help for role-based access control, SSL/TLS encryption, and row-level safety to limit entry to specific rows in a desk. In basic, MongoDB tends to perform better on read-heavy workloads that involve querying and retrieving knowledge, because of its document-oriented data model and indexing capabilities. However, it can wrestle with write-heavy workloads that contain frequent updates and inserts.